### Step 7: Enable bulk edits

The admin table in Marrowfield now supports bulk edits behind a flag. Verify the batch endpoint is deployed before flipping it, since partial rollouts cause silent row-level failures. Review the transaction size limits carefully. The feature requires the following configuration values to be set.

service settings:
[casax]
port = 6379
team = rusir
host = casax.zemvarhq.corp
region = outer-4
access_code = ac_9808ce
timeout_ms = 1500

Handover: Routefall driver-assignment heuristic, from Dasha to Orin. Scoring weights live in assign_weights.yml; changes bypass config review. Heuristic reads driver geodata unfiltered — flag for the security pass. Fallback path skips the audit log when the queue saturates. No auth on the internal tuning endpoint yet. Known gaps are tracked on the Routefall security checklist page.

runbook for badug-kadup: https://confluence.zemvarlabs.internal/projects/browse/display/projects/bd1b

☐ Landlord site audit — Greyharbor Properties walkthrough scheduled during your shift. New starter shadows you; brief them first. Clear the loading bay, unlock stairwell doors on floors 2–4, and have the maintenance log ready at the desk. Auditor signs in, gets an escort badge, stays with you the whole time. Relock everything after. The roof-access panel stays shut unless the auditor asks; if so, open it with the code below.

staff pass of hawef-tawip = bdg-KRP-2

## Runbook: Connection Pool Changes

Plugin authors integrating with the Ostermill data layer: release 7.1 caps per-plugin pool size at twelve connections and enforces a two-second acquisition timeout. Audit your plugins for long-held connections and release them promptly, or requests will queue and time out. After updating, run the pool stress check in the sandbox. Signed plugin packages only — sign your archive with the key below.

release key, fafof-hawip: bky6_52YEwQ